How to Apply for a Germany Tourist Visa:

Planning a trip to Germany to explore its rich history, vibrant culture, and scenic landscapes? If you’re a citizen of a country that requires a visa to enter Germany, you’ll need to apply for a Schengen Short-Stay Visa (Type C). This visa allows you to stay in Germany and other Schengen countries for up to 90 days within a 180-day period.​Haven Travel and Tour BlogHowToVisa

📄 Documents Required for a Germany Tourist Visa

 Germany Tourist Visa

Preparing the correct documentation is crucial for a successful application. Here’s a checklist to guide you:​

  • Visa Application FormHow to Apply for a Germany Tourist Visa: Completed and signed.
  • Completed and signed.
  • Valid Passport:How to Apply for a Germany Tourist Visa: Issued within the last 10 years and valid for at least three months beyond your intended departure from the Schengen area.
  • Passport-sized Photograph: Recent and meeting Schengen visa photo requirements.
  • Travel Itinerary: Proof of round-trip flight bookings.
  • Accommodation Details: Hotel reservations or invitation letter from a host in Germany.
  • Travel Insurance: Coverage of at least €30,000 for medical emergencies and repatriation.
  • Proof of Financial Means: Bank statements or income proof demonstrating sufficient funds for your trip.
  • Employment or Student Status: Letter from employer or educational institution confirming your status.
  • Cover Letter: Explaining the purpose of your visit and itinerary.​Germany Visa+2Germany Visa+2Germany Visa+2

Note: Additional documents may be required based on individual circumstances. Always consult the official guidelines or your local German embassy for specifics.​Germany Visa


📝 Step-by-Step Application Process

1. Determine Visa Requirement

Confirm whether you need a visa by checking the German Federal Foreign Office.​

2. Complete the Visa Application Form

Fill out the application form accurately. Some embassies may require online submission via the VIDEX system.​

3. Schedule an Appointment

Book an appointment at the German embassy, consulate, or authorized visa application center in your country.​Germany Visa+2Germany Visa+2How-to-Germany.com+2

4. Prepare Your Documents

Gather all required documents as outlined above.​

5. Attend the Visa Interview

Submit your application and documents in person. You may be asked questions about your travel plans and intentions.​

6. Pay the Visa Fee

The standard fee for a short-stay Schengen visa is €80. Fees may vary based on nationality and age.​Schengen Insurance Info

7. Wait for Processing

Processing times can range from 5 to 15 working days. It’s advisable to apply at least 15 days before your intended travel date.​

8. Collect Your Visa

Once approved, collect your passport with the visa sticker affixed. Ensure all details are correct upon receipt.​


💡 Tips for a Successful Application

  • Apply Early: Start the process at least a month before your planned travel date.
  • Ensure Accuracy: Double-check all information and documents for accuracy.
  • Demonstrate Financial Stability: Provide clear evidence of sufficient funds.
  • Provide a Detailed Itinerary: Outline your daily activities to show a well-planned trip.
  • Consult the Embassy: For any uncertainties, reach out to the German embassy or consulate in your area.​
